October 18, 2006

DemoWolf releases new H-Sphere tutorials

(Nova Scotia, Canada) - DemoWolf has just released 30 new tutorials for the H-Sphere web hosting control panel. These new tutorials are perfect for hosting companies offering H-Sphere, to give their customers real-time help in using all aspects of H-Sphere. 

"These new H-Sphere tutorials are our latest in a long list of web hosting control panel tutorials" says Rob Moore, CEO of DemoWolf. "We pride ourselves on producing the highest quality tutorials in the industry, so that our customers (hosting companies) can look their very best in providing this free service to their customers.  

DemoWolf is currently working on new tutorial series for Alabanza and Ensim PRO, as well as new voice/audio tutorials for WebHost Manager.

DemoWolf is also working on a new desktop application that hosting companies will be able to offer to their customers for free. This application is being designed to help facilitate the communications channel between customer and host. Details will be made available in the coming days/weeks, with an expected launch date of November 1, 2006.

About DemoWolf
DemoWolf is an internet services company based in Halifax, Nova Scotia, Canada. With over 800 available custom branded tutorials for the web hosting industry, as well as providing custom tutorials and voice tutorials for many other online applications, DemoWolf is the fastest growing tutorial provider in the industry.
